1.     Opening weekend at a glance

What an opener! The perfect launchpad for the 2025 Women’s Rugby World Cup.

To kick things off, the Red Roses secured 69-7 victory over the USA in front of an electric crowd of 42,723 fans in Sunderland, and our very own Sadia Kabeya scored the first try of the tournament. A sensational start.

The energy only grew as the weekend unfolded. Saturday’s match in Exeter saw France taking the win against Italy. Our highlight? Watching Gilbert Ambassador, Charlotte Escudero, charging through a decisive try in the second half to help seal the win.

The entire weekend was a display of firsts and an incredible showcase of athleticism and team spirit, especially for Brazil, who made their historic debut at the Rugby World Cup 2025, brimming with pride despite the scoreline.
